Cholo happy with Atleti response

Diego Simeone accepted Real Madrid started better in the Copa del Rey meeting between the sides but was happy with how Atletico Madrid replied.

A Raul Garcia penalty and a goal from Jose Gimenez gave the champions victory over the League leaders and Cholo said after the match that he was happy with how his players recovered after Madrid’s stronger start.

“Madrid started better but my guys responded well. Lucas, very young, very good…Gamez, Mario…Fernando Torres’ presence…,” the Coach considered, AS reports.

“We settled in the first half and were more competitive over time. The second half was very good. We worked well and we were tidy.

“The changes gave vitality to the team and that allowed us to occupy the spaces and close down well.

“We wanted to play our best XI and put out a competitive team, so we could have more patience and press. We pressed well in attack.

“Saul played well when out wide and Garcia did a commendable job. The team is competitive, we compete and we have competition in us.

“Torres showed enthusiasm, energy. He was strong and fast but needs time to get used to his teammates but as the minutes went on he felt better.”

Simeone also touched on the signing of Cani, who was confirmed as arriving on loan from Villarreal shortly before kick-off.

“He’s another talent with Koke, Arda Turan and Antoine Griezmann,” he noted.

“He will allow us to try variants and gives us more competition.”
